The Allure of Konkan’s Spiritual Heritage
When you step into the Konkan temple, you enter a world where time seems to slow down. The scent of incense fills the air, the sound of temple bells echoes softly, and the intricate carvings on ancient walls tell stories of devotion spanning centuries. This temple is not just a place of worship—it’s a living museum of local beliefs and customs, offering a glimpse into the soul of the Konkan region.
Locals and pilgrims alike visit to seek blessings, make offerings, and participate in rituals passed down through generations. The temple’s architecture reflects a harmonious blend of coastal influences, with stone carvings, wooden pillars, and beautifully painted ceilings. Every corner holds a symbol, a deity, or a legend that ties the people of Konkan to their roots.
